Explanation:
Nitrogen is a part of vital organic compounds in microrganisms, such as amino acids, proteins and DNA. ... During the conversion of nitrogen cyano bacteria will first convert nitrogen into ammonia and ammonium, during the nitrogen fixation process. Plants can use ammonia as a nitrogen source.
